Saleem Abdulrasool 2aded1f5c7 MC: rename Win64EHFrameInfo to WinEH::FrameInfo
The frame information stored in this structure is driven by the requirements for
Windows NT unwinding rather than Windows 64 specifically.  As a result, this
type can be shared across multiple architectures (ARM, AXP, MIPS, PPC, SH).
Rename this class in preparation for adding support for supporting unwinding
information for Windows on ARM.

Take the opportunity to constify the members as everything except the
ChainedParent is read-only.  This required some adjustment to the label
handling.

//===- MCWinEH.h - Windows Unwinding Support --------------------*- C++ -*-===//
//
// The LLVM Compiler Infrastructure
//
// This file is distributed under the University of Illinois Open Source
// License. See LICENSE.TXT for details.
//
//===----------------------------------------------------------------------===//
#ifndef LLVM_MC_MCWINEH_H
#define LLVM_MC_MCWINEH_H
#include <vector>
namespace llvm {
class MCSymbol;
namespace WinEH {
struct Instruction {
const MCSymbol *Label;
const unsigned Offset;
const unsigned Register;
const unsigned Operation;
Instruction(unsigned Op, MCSymbol *L, unsigned Reg, unsigned Off)
: Label(L), Offset(Off), Register(Reg), Operation(Op) {}
};
struct FrameInfo {
const MCSymbol *Begin;
const MCSymbol *End;
const MCSymbol *ExceptionHandler;
const MCSymbol *Function;
const MCSymbol *PrologEnd;
const MCSymbol *Symbol;
bool HandlesUnwind;
bool HandlesExceptions;
int LastFrameInst;
const FrameInfo *ChainedParent;
std::vector<Instruction> Instructions;
FrameInfo()
: Begin(nullptr), End(nullptr), ExceptionHandler(nullptr),
Function(nullptr), PrologEnd(nullptr), Symbol(nullptr),
HandlesUnwind(false), HandlesExceptions(false), LastFrameInst(-1),
ChainedParent(nullptr), Instructions() {}
FrameInfo(const MCSymbol *Function, const MCSymbol *BeginFuncEHLabel)
: Begin(BeginFuncEHLabel), End(nullptr), ExceptionHandler(nullptr),
Function(Function), PrologEnd(nullptr), Symbol(nullptr),
HandlesUnwind(false), HandlesExceptions(false), LastFrameInst(-1),
ChainedParent(nullptr), Instructions() {}
FrameInfo(const MCSymbol *Function, const MCSymbol *BeginFuncEHLabel,
const FrameInfo *ChainedParent)
: Begin(BeginFuncEHLabel), End(nullptr), ExceptionHandler(nullptr),
Function(Function), PrologEnd(nullptr), Symbol(nullptr),
HandlesUnwind(false), HandlesExceptions(false), LastFrameInst(-1),
ChainedParent(ChainedParent), Instructions() {}
};
}
}
#endif
